According to dual code theory, human brains record information with 2 different representations. The first one is through verbal representation that utilize the left side of the brain. The second one is through non-verbal representation that utilize the right side of the brain.
In the example above, seeing the organism serves as non-verbal representation that utilized the right brain, and naming the organism serves as verbal representation that utilize the left side of the brain.

<u>Answer:</u>
The development of chemicals used as fertilizers to increase the quality of soil revolutionized agriculture is a TRUE statement.
<u>Explanation:</u>
- In order to increase their nutritional levels of the soil, the soil is artificially nurtured by adding various chemicals to it.
- These chemicals majorly consist of phosphorus, nitrogen, potassium, etc.
- Adding such chemicals to the soil in optimum quantity helps the crops to thrive and grow rich in content.
- The development and use of chemical fertilizers has not only increased the quality of the crop but has also considerably increased the quantity of the output.
